Explanation
Southbound APIs are used to communicate between the SDN controller and the switches and routers within the infrastructure. OpenFlow and Cisco OpFlex provide southbound API capabilities. OpenFlow is the standard southbound protocol used between the SDN controller and the switch. The SDN controller takes the information from the applications and converts them into flow entries, which are fed to the switch via OF. It can also be used for monitoring switch and port statistics in network
